国产不卡在线观看视频_日本高清久久_天天操天天干天天摸_一区二区三区视频在线

歡迎來到通信人在線![用戶登錄] [免費(fèi)注冊(cè)]

關(guān)于內(nèi)容傳送網(wǎng)絡(luò)(CDN)技術(shù)

瀏覽:3465  來源:通信人在線  日期:2006-10-20
 

隨著多媒體技術(shù)的不斷發(fā)展,圖像、音頻、視頻服務(wù)所占的比重越來越大。傳統(tǒng)的緩存技術(shù)只能存儲(chǔ)靜態(tài)超文本鏈接標(biāo)識(shí)語(yǔ)言(HTML)文件和圖片等比較小的文件,而對(duì)交互性強(qiáng)和比較大的文件并不支持,因此迫切需要一種新的傳輸結(jié)構(gòu)解決這一問題。和緩存技術(shù)類似,CDN也設(shè)立若干分支節(jié)點(diǎn),盡量將用戶請(qǐng)求的內(nèi)容存儲(chǔ)到距離用戶只有“最后一公里”的邊緣節(jié)點(diǎn)上,使得用戶請(qǐng)求可以在本地進(jìn)行,改善用戶的訪問效果。

內(nèi)容傳送網(wǎng)絡(luò)(CDNContent distribution network)提供了一種傳送內(nèi)容的新型體系結(jié)構(gòu),將在Web體系結(jié)構(gòu)中起到越來越重要的作用。CDN最早于1998年推出,在Web體系結(jié)構(gòu)中緩存技術(shù)的基礎(chǔ)上發(fā)展起來,因此是緩存技術(shù)的延續(xù)與發(fā)展。

CDN能夠取得成功的關(guān)鍵在于CDN本質(zhì)上是一個(gè)重疊網(wǎng)絡(luò)(ON)。作為ONCDN可以充分利用CDN端節(jié)點(diǎn)的合作實(shí)現(xiàn)文件傳輸。首先,CDN端節(jié)點(diǎn)可以和路由器一樣轉(zhuǎn)發(fā)包。也就是說,兩個(gè)CDN節(jié)點(diǎn)間的通信可以使用第3個(gè)節(jié)點(diǎn)充當(dāng)中間節(jié)點(diǎn)進(jìn)行轉(zhuǎn)發(fā),因此兩個(gè)CDN節(jié)點(diǎn)間可形成多個(gè)底層(IP層)連接,提高了數(shù)據(jù)傳輸?shù)目煽啃院托省F浯危捎?/SPAN>CDN節(jié)點(diǎn)間形成了多個(gè)底層連接,端節(jié)點(diǎn)之間的帶寬可以超過底層網(wǎng)絡(luò)的限制。這兩個(gè)特點(diǎn)使得CDN非常適合大文件的傳輸。

目前,進(jìn)入商用階段的CDN越來越多,每個(gè)CDN由少至數(shù)十、多至上萬(wàn)個(gè)節(jié)點(diǎn)組成。如Akamai使用遍布于全球的超過800個(gè)網(wǎng)絡(luò)的1萬(wàn)多個(gè)節(jié)點(diǎn)實(shí)現(xiàn)內(nèi)容傳送。

根據(jù)使用范圍的不同,現(xiàn)有的CDN模型可分為3類。

1、公共CDN公共CDN就是平常所指的CDN,值得注意的是,由于用途不同,公共CDN分化出多種不同的結(jié)構(gòu),如適合無線傳輸?shù)?/SPAN>CDN結(jié)構(gòu)、適合流媒體傳輸?shù)?/SPAN>CDN結(jié)構(gòu)等。

2、企業(yè)CDN企業(yè)CDNECDN)與公共CDN不同,這種私有的CDN網(wǎng)絡(luò)節(jié)點(diǎn)位于企業(yè)內(nèi)部網(wǎng)的防火墻內(nèi),可以在企業(yè)的廣域網(wǎng)(WAN)內(nèi)分發(fā)企業(yè)數(shù)據(jù),其規(guī)模比公共CDN小。ECDN中內(nèi)容放置點(diǎn)應(yīng)盡量距離終端近(在一個(gè)網(wǎng)段內(nèi)),對(duì)于高度交互性的應(yīng)用如網(wǎng)絡(luò)化學(xué)習(xí)、會(huì)議電視等很有效。與公共CDN最大的不同在于ECDN對(duì)用戶的控制程度強(qiáng)得多。在公共CDN中,系統(tǒng)不對(duì)哪個(gè)用戶可以訪問內(nèi)容進(jìn)行接入控制,而在ECDN中,系統(tǒng)對(duì)用戶的了解和控制要嚴(yán)格得多。

3、臨時(shí)CDN由于使用CDN來發(fā)布內(nèi)容需要支付的維護(hù)成本比較高,對(duì)中小內(nèi)容提供者尤其是大多數(shù)時(shí)間使用自己的服務(wù)器能夠處理用戶請(qǐng)求,僅在發(fā)布軟件、公布重要消息等用戶請(qǐng)求突然增大的時(shí)候需要使用CDN來提供服務(wù)的用戶需求,沒有必要使用一般意義上的CDN。臨時(shí)性CDN使用基于因特網(wǎng)底板協(xié)議(IBP)的物流網(wǎng)絡(luò)進(jìn)行臨時(shí)性內(nèi)容傳送,而不與內(nèi)容提供者簽署長(zhǎng)期協(xié)議。IBP提供了一個(gè)管理和使用遠(yuǎn)端存儲(chǔ)空間的中間件。與傳統(tǒng)網(wǎng)絡(luò)模型不同,IBP將網(wǎng)絡(luò)的底層物理資源如存儲(chǔ)、計(jì)算等功能集成到網(wǎng)絡(luò)中,用戶使用Internet就如同使用一個(gè)處理器平臺(tái),這也是其稱為物流網(wǎng)絡(luò)的原因。IBP提供了對(duì)網(wǎng)絡(luò)存儲(chǔ)資源的時(shí)間受限訪問,因此可以構(gòu)造自組織(Ad hoc)內(nèi)容分布網(wǎng)絡(luò)。

一個(gè)CDN通常包括邊緣節(jié)點(diǎn)傳輸、內(nèi)容路由、集中式內(nèi)容分布和管理(負(fù)責(zé)內(nèi)容在不同節(jié)點(diǎn)的同步和復(fù)制)、集中式內(nèi)容發(fā)布等功能。

CDN中的核心技術(shù)主要包括兩個(gè)方面:一是基于內(nèi)容的請(qǐng)求路由(即重定向)和內(nèi)容搜索,二是內(nèi)容的分發(fā)與管理。其他技術(shù)如負(fù)載均衡等可以通過這兩個(gè)技術(shù)實(shí)現(xiàn)。

由于CDN技術(shù)是緩存技術(shù)的發(fā)展,有必要分析一下CDN和緩存技術(shù)的主要區(qū)別。CDN和緩存技術(shù)的區(qū)別主要體現(xiàn)在以下幾個(gè)方面:

1)節(jié)點(diǎn)之間關(guān)系不同

緩存節(jié)點(diǎn)之間既可以是合作的,也可以是不合作的。如果需要構(gòu)造合作關(guān)系,由于緩存節(jié)點(diǎn)分屬不同的因特網(wǎng)業(yè)務(wù)提供商(ISP),各緩存節(jié)點(diǎn)之間需要專門的合作式緩存協(xié)議來支持。CDN的各個(gè)節(jié)點(diǎn)則屬于同一個(gè)機(jī)構(gòu),它們之間天然地形成合作關(guān)系,不需要額外的協(xié)議支持。

2)服務(wù)對(duì)象不同

CDN主要存儲(chǔ)圖像、視頻、音頻等較大文件,而緩存技術(shù)主要存放靜態(tài)的小文件。

3)存儲(chǔ)機(jī)制不同

CDN和緩存技術(shù)采用不同的文件獲取方式。CDN使用預(yù)存儲(chǔ)來減少大文件時(shí)傳輸?shù)难舆t,而緩存采用被動(dòng)的根據(jù)用戶請(qǐng)求的on-demand機(jī)制。CDN的存儲(chǔ)代價(jià)較高。

4)更新方式不同

CDN與內(nèi)容提供者之間的更新既可根據(jù)預(yù)定的內(nèi)容更新策略向內(nèi)容提供者主動(dòng)要求(執(zhí)行pull),又可由內(nèi)容提供者主動(dòng)向CDN的存儲(chǔ)節(jié)點(diǎn)發(fā)布更新內(nèi)容(執(zhí)行push),而緩存技術(shù)只能被動(dòng)地從內(nèi)容提供者那里獲得內(nèi)容。因此對(duì)于某個(gè)首次請(qǐng)求的對(duì)象,使用CDN技術(shù)用戶可以直接從CDN節(jié)點(diǎn)獲得該對(duì)象,而使用緩存技術(shù)的用戶必須從源站點(diǎn)獲得。同時(shí)緩存技術(shù)的被動(dòng)更新機(jī)制使得緩存內(nèi)容與原內(nèi)容不一致的可能性增大,從而可能造成用戶請(qǐng)求錯(cuò)誤。

5)同內(nèi)容提供者的關(guān)系不同

CDN和內(nèi)容提供者之間存在某種契約關(guān)系,因此CDN代表內(nèi)容提供者提供服務(wù)(從用戶的角度來看,CDN和內(nèi)容提供者是一致的);采用緩存技術(shù)的運(yùn)營(yíng)商與內(nèi)容提供者之間不存在契約關(guān)系,會(huì)發(fā)生采用緩存技術(shù)的運(yùn)營(yíng)商和內(nèi)容提供者搶用戶的情況,造成內(nèi)容提供者潛在損失。

6)功能不同

CDN包括內(nèi)容復(fù)制、轉(zhuǎn)向、緩存、服務(wù)質(zhì)量提供/流量整形、加密套接字協(xié)議層加速、分布式代理/服務(wù)驗(yàn)證等功能,功能遠(yuǎn)多于緩存技術(shù)。

© 2004-2025 通信人在線 版權(quán)所有 備案號(hào):粵ICP備06113876號(hào) 網(wǎng)站技術(shù):做網(wǎng)站